Ak Nonganba Death Case: Demand raised to disclose arrested person’s statement

Akoijam Nonganba alias Aging, 41, from Kwakeithel Awang Konjeng Leikai, Imphal West was found dead under mysterious circumstances at Changoubung under Kangpokpi Police Station, Manipur on February 12.

The JAC in connection with the death of Ak Nonganba and Nupi Samaj on Sunday demanded the authorities that the statements given to police by Thokchom Sonia who has been arrested in connection with the case be disclosed to the JAC and Nupi Samaj as well as the public.

A release signed by JAC Convenor Th Ashalata stated that the resolution to raise the said demand was taken during a meeting with the JAC, Nupi Samaj and meira paibi organisations at Awang Konjeng Leikai Community Hall, Imphal West on Saturday.      

The meeting further reaffirmed the JAC’s demand to arrest the remaining accused person, failing which an intensive stir will continue indefinitely, and the body of Ak Nonganba will not be taken, it stated.  

Thokchom Sonia had been remanded in a seven-day police custody after she was produced before JMIC Kangpokpi. She had allegedly traveled with Nonganba a day before he was found dead. She was arrested from IT Road Bazar by Kangpokpi district police.

In connection with the case, one deputy kilonser of NSCN (I-M), Moses Gonmei, 42, from Katomei Namgailong in Senapati district was arrested and remanded in 11-day police custody after he was produced before JMIC Kangpokpi on February 14.

Akoijam Nonganba alias Aging, 41, son of former minister (L) Pilot Langam from Kwakeithel Awang Konjeng Leikai, Imphal West was found dead under mysterious circumstances at Changoubung under Kangpokpi Police Station, Manipur on February 12.
